Output 07efa23490ed4b6908fee2a450203cc01ebde02258b01acaa1de4bad91ebc563:0

value
2587218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64adf0fa7b21e6782bf673ccd6035d7b404cbc5 OP_EQUAL
address
3JJtbcEWaDqLurhqWt8E5nMwSkkjKJxJWn
transaction
07efa23490ed4b6908fee2a450203cc01ebde02258b01acaa1de4bad91ebc563
spent
true